                  June 6, 2018:

                  Hearn, speaking to ESPN from his home in England, said he was pleased to hear from Gomez and hopes to finalize the fight.

                  "I can tell you that we love the fight," Hearn said. "It's a fight that when I signed Daniel Jacobs he told me he believes he beats Canelo every day of the week. We had a brief conversation with Golden Boy about a week ago or so [when Alvarez-Golovkin negotiations were first on the ropes] and it was hard to tell whether it was part of the plan in the negotiations with Canelo-Golovkin or if they really wanted the fight. We confirmed our interest and today we received an official offer to fight Canelo on Sept. 15.

                  "I've taken the offer to Keith Connolly, Danny's manager, Danny. We're extremely interested. Obviously, it's a huge fight."

                  Hearn said he hoped to make the deal quickly and didn't intend on dragging things out.

                  "It's a first offer and we are not looking to be difficult, but we know our value in the fight," Hearn said. "We have a guy in Daniel Jacobs who, in my opinion, beat Gennady Golovkin but in anybody's opinion had a wonderful fight with Golovkin which many couldn't split. In that respect, I see Jacobs as the perfect guy to fight Canelo.

                  "This is one of the reasons we signed with HBO -- to get this fight. Now we're here. I will push for every dime for my client. At the same time we realize this is a wonderful opportunity and we'll do everything we can to make this fight. This is a major, major, major fight for Danny Jacobs. We know the money involved in the fight. We believe it does big pay-per-view numbers."

                  De La Hoya said he hoped to also wrap it up quickly.

                  "The deadline is going to be middle of this month because we have to start promoting and lock down everything," he said. "Our sponsors are ready to go and we want to give the fight fans the best possible fight, and unfortunately GGG didn't budge from his 50-50, so we're moving on."
